The S&G D-Drive™ & Rotary Drive lock combines ease of operation with security and flexibility. Its advanced electronic circuit design makes it easy to open and easy to change codes. Follow these instructions carefully to get the best possible use from your lock. S&G DIRECT DRIVE / ZO3 & ROTARY DRIVE

• The lock can be set to accept a supervisor code, up to seven different user codes, and a time delay override code. The master code holder and the supervisor code holder (if a supervisor code is set) are responsible for maintaining the number of active users programmed into each lock. The master code holder and the supervisor code holder can create and delete user codes. • The master code is designated as code #0. The supervisor code (if set) is designated as code #1. The user codes (if set) are designated by user position numbers 2, 3, 4, 5, 6, 7, and 8. The time delay override code (if set) is designated as code #9. • Each time a button is pressed, the lock acknowledges it by sounding a “beep,” and the LED on the keypad will light momentarily as the “beep” sounds. If it does not, check your battery (or batteries) to make sure it is fresh and connected properly, then try again.

• All codes end with #. This signals the lock that you have finished entering all digits of the code.

• If you pause more than 10 seconds between button presses when entering a code, the lock will assume you do not want to continue, and it will reset itself to the original code. To open the lock, begin the code entry sequence once again from the first step.

• If you realize you have pressed an incorrect button when entering a code, press ** or simply pause ten seconds or more, then begin entering your code again.

• If five incorrect codes are entered in a row, the lock will shut down for ten minutes.

This is a security feature. Entering a code during this period will result in two long error tones (braps). Pressing any buttons during the lockout period will not affect the penalty timer. After ten minutes, the lock should operate normally. • Avoid codes which can be easily guessed.
